Protecting What Matters Most: Life Insurance Explained
Life insurance is a legal agreement that provides your loved ones with a death benefit if you succumb unexpectedly. It's designed to help your family cover essential expenses, such as housing costs, funeral arrangements, and childcare expenses.
There are two main types of life insurance: term life insurance and permanent life insurance. Term life insurance provides coverage for a defined period, such as 10, 20, or 30 years. Permanent life insurance offers lifelong coverage and often includes a savings component.
When choosing the right life insurance policy for your needs, consider factors like your health, your loved ones' needs, and your future plans. It's always a good idea to consult with a qualified planner who can help you navigate the complexities of life insurance and find a policy that satisfies your specific circumstances.
